The invention relates to the technical field of lifting appliances, in particular to an electromagnetic floating type lifting appliance which comprises a plurality of trusses, a fixing frame and a plurality of electromagnets arranged in an array mode, a lifting mechanism used for driving the fixing frame to ascend or descend is arranged on the trusses, and the electromagnets are arranged on the fixing frame in a floating mode. When the electromagnetic floating type lifting appliance is used, the electromagnets which are arranged in an array mode are arranged on the fixing frame in a floating mode, so that the electromagnets have a certain moving space, the electromagnets are prevented from colliding with a steel plate in a hard mode, the electromagnets have a certain buffering space, and therefore the electromagnets are prevented from being damaged. The problems that when an electromagnet of an existing magnetic type lifting appliance attracts a steel plate, the phenomenon that the electromagnet and the steel plate collide with each other easily occurs, so that the steel plate or the electromagnet is damaged, the quality of equipment or the steel plate is affected, and unnecessary damage is caused are solved.
